There are multiple courses which you can undertake in order to get a job at the airport. The courses are as follows:
1. BBA in Airport Management:
- A BBA course is a three year undergraduate programme which lets a student choose his specialisation in certain area or discipline which in your case is airport management.
- After this course it is preferred that a student does pursue his MBA in order to enhance career prospects and recruitment opportunities.
- This course is done for administrative and mangerial positions in an airport.
- The course covers topics like accounting, human resource management, introduction to airport management, financial management, safety management, marketing etc.
- Students who have passed their 12th grade from any stream from a recognised board can apply for this course. Minimum marks required range from 50-60%.
- After this course the student gets hired at Domestic and International airports. The average starting salary ranges from INR 3-6 lakh. Job positions for which one gets recruited after this course inclde administrator, airport manager, safety officer, staff manager etc.
2. Diploma in Airport Management:
- This course lasts for one year and is solely focussed on airport management. It doesn't posses that much of a value as a BBA degree, however you can improve your chances at getting good job opportunities by doing a post graduation diploma in airport management.
- The topics covered in this course include airport strategy and functioning, staff management, cargo management and handling, safety and security management etc.
- In order to be eligible for this course a student must have done his 12th grade from any stream from a recognised board.
- Top recruiter after this course will be domestic and international airports. The average starting salary ranges between INR 2-5 lakh. Major positions for which one gets recruited include assistant manager, airport manager, cargo department managet etc.
3. Diploma in Ground Staff and Cabin Crew Training:
- The course duration often varies between 6 months to 1 year.
- Topics taught in the span of the course include customer services, communication skills, in flight training, food and beverages production and serving, safety and first aid procedure training etc.
- In order to be eligible for this course a student must have done his 12th grade from any stream from a recognised board.
- Candidates after this course are eligible for roles of flight attendants, ground staff. Major roles include those of air hostesses and stewards, front and office operator etc. The average starting salary ranges between INR 4-6 lakh.
4. Diploma in Aviation Hospitality:
- The course duration is of one year. The topics subjects covered in this course are communication skills, introduction to aviation hospitality, management, foreign languages, food and beverage production, computer and IT skills, front office operations etc.
- In order to be eligible for this course a student must have done his 12th grade from any stream from a recognised board.
- Candidates after this course are eligible for roles of flight attendants, ground staff. Major roles include those of air hostesses and stewards, front and office operator etc. The average starting salary ranges between INR 4-6 lakh.
5. Diploma in Airfare and Ticketing Management:
- It is a one year course. It is mainly for candidates who prefer groun duty jobs. It is available both full time and part time.
- The course covers subjects like airline codes, electronic ticketing, ticketing terminology, passports and visas, airfares and ticketing software, foreign exchange etc.
- In order to be eligible for this course a student must have done his 12th grade from any stream from a recognised board.
- The students of this course will be able to find jobs at the front office, airline customer care and service department etc. Average starting salary of a student from this course ranges between INR 2-3 lakh.

CA Intermediate Eligibility -
1) A candidate becomes eligible to register for Intermediate only after passing (10+2) examination conducted by an examining body constituted by law and also after passing CPT (Common Proficiency Test) or CA Foundation (introduced by ICAI as per the new scheme).
2) There is also a direct entry route through which a candidate can enroll for Intermediate directly without going through Either CPT or CA Foundation.
3) Students who are Graduate/ Post Graduate in Commerce and secured a minimum of 55% can register directly for Intermediate without passing CA Foundation or CPT.
Similarly like Commerce Graduates, Non commerce Graduates/ Post Graduates can also register for Intermediate by securing 60% marks in Graduation/ Post Graduation.
Apart from the above, the students who cleared the Intermediate level of the Institute of Cost Accountants of India or The Institute of Company Secretaries of India.

The above students can get register directly for the Intermediate level without passing entrance level.
The students who are appearing in the Intermediate examinations through the Foundation route are required to undergo 8 months of study period after registering for Intermediate Course.
The candidates who are there in the last year of their graduation can register for the Intermediate course on the Provisional basis.
However, they can commence practical training only on the successful submission of the proof that they have passed their graduation successfully with the specified percentage discussed above. During this provisional registration period, they can complete ITT (Information Technology) and O.P (Orientation Programme). But if they failed to produce such evidence then their provisional registration shall stand canceled and fees will neither be refunded nor be adjusted. Addition to this, if he has undergone through theoretical Educational Programme then no credit shall be given of such.
ITT and OP training must be completed before commencement of practical training for the graduate students / Post Graduate students who are taking direct entry in the CA Course.
And in order to appear in the Intermediate examination, they need to successfully complete nine months of practical training.
However, the candidates who are registered directly in the CA Intermediate after clearing the Intermediate level of The Institute of Cost Accountants of India or The Institute of Company Secretaries of India are eligible to appear in the Intermediate examination after undergone through 8 months of study period similar like students who are appearing through the CA Foundation route.

Chartered Accountancy is a professional course regulated by ICAI, a statutory body and no university/college can offer this course. Details about this course are elaborated below. It is a correspondence course regulated by a statutory professional body, the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India (ICAI). Admission to the CA course is open throughout the year and examinations are held twice a year in May and November. It is a minimum 4 years course depending on how fast you clear your papers.
Over the years, the Chartered Accountancy profession has achieved rapid growth by virtue of quality professional services being rendered by its members, and has come to occupy a prominent role in our economy and society. The profession deals with main area of auditing in the corporates, be it statutory audit, cost audit, internal audit.
The ICAI allows the following candidates to enter directly to its Intermediate Course:
A. Commerce Graduates/Post-Graduates (with minimum 55% marks) or Other Graduates/Post-Graduates (with minimum 60% marks) and
B. Intermediate level passed candidates of Institute of Company Secretaries of India and Institute of Cost Accountants of India
C. Students who have passed 10+2 can enter into this course after qualifying CA Foundation Programme.
If you want to join the course after 10+2 pass or equivalent you need to undergo THREE STAGES:
1.CA Foundation Programme
2. CA Intermediate Programme
3. CA Final Programme
There are 4 papers in CA Foundation Programme, 8 papers divided into two groups in CA Intermediate Programme and 8 papers divided into two groups in CA Final Programme. You need to clear all the papers of every stage to reach the next level.
In Foundation Programme you need to appear for all four papers at once. Whereas in Intermediate and Final programme you can appear for examination either for all modules together or for a single module at one time. Admission fee is nominal and has to be paid once when enrolling for a particular programme but examination fee has to be paid everytime you appear/re-appear for your examination.
Qualifying Marks: A candidate is declared to have passed the Foundation/Intermediate/Final Programme, if he/she secures in one sitting atleast 40% in each paper and 50% in aggregate of all subjects.
- After entering the intermediate course, a student has to Undergo Four Weeks Integrated Course on Information Technology and Soft skills (ICITSS) consisting of Courses on Information Technology and Orientation Course at the earliest but these are to be completed compulsorily before commencement of their articleship.
- After clearing either of the Group or Both Groups of Intermediate Course and after successfully undergoing ICITSS, you have to go through Practical training/Articleship in a Corporate or with a Practising Chartered Accountancy Firm. Once you become a qualified Chartered Accountant, you can work with any Company or practise on your own.
- After entering the final course, a student has to successfully undergo Four Weeks Advanced Integrated Course on Information Technology and Soft skills (AICITSS) consisting of Courses on Advanced Information Technology and Management Communication Skills during the last two years of practical training but before appearing in the Final Examination.
- A student has to complete 3 years of practical training alonside preparing for his final exams.

The following Masters programmes are offered by the university:
- Master of Arts (Education)
- Master of Arts (Development)
- Master of Arts (Public Policy & Governance)
- Master of Laws (Law & Development)
- Master of Arts (Economics) -New programme from 2019
ELIGIBILITY:
• For Master of Arts Programme - Undergraduate degree in any discipline
• For Master of Laws Programme - Bachelor’s degree in Law
Students graduating in 2019 may also apply. Applicants with prior work experience are encouraged to apply and are given additional weightage in the interview process.
TEST AND INTERVIEW:
1.Master of Arts programmes (M.A.): Admissions are through an entrance test (common for all the postgraduate programmes held in February), followed by personal interviews for shortlisted applicants. Tests and interviews in various locations across the country, providing easy access for students.
2.Master of Laws (Law & Development): University entrance test and through scores of other entrance tests applicable for postgraduate courses in law.
3.Master of Arts (Economics): Students applying for the M.A. in Economics will need to pass an online entrance test consisting of multiple choice questions and an essay question. The MCQ's will test definitional and conceptual foundational economics knowledge from microeconomics, macroeconomics, political economy, the Indian economy and quantitative methods.All applicants will appear for a test based on topics found in an undergraduate degree in Economics.
FEES AND F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E: 2019-20
1. M.A. Education/M.A. Development/ M.A. Public Policy and Governance
Full progrramme fee for 4 semesters is Rs. 150,000 (Tuition fee), with Accomodation and food charges Rs. 256000.
2. LL.M. (Law and Development)
Full progrramme fee annually is Rs. 75,000 (Tuition fee), with Accomodation and food charges Rs. 128000
3. M.A. in Economic
Full progrramme fee for 4 semesters is Rs. 150,000 (Tuition fee).
*Family income of less than Rupees 5 Lakhs per annum will be considered for various categories of scholarships.
ABOUT THE PROGRAMMES
1.The Master of Arts - Education Programme is a broad-based programme of study that includes theory, practice, research, policy and planning in education. It has sought to forge interconnections with the larger context of education in India along with the range of principles and practices that inform education studies today. It attempts to develop educational professionals capable of analysis, reflection, conceptual thinking, and meaningful action.
2.The M.A. Development requires full-time engagement for two academic years, including one summer and one winter break. Core courses are expected to provide adequate knowledge, competencies and orientations to embark on a deeper exploration of specific themes. These courses are mandatory for all students. Elective courses will enhance two broad competencies, namely critical analysis and imaginative practice and cover a wide range of topics to choose from.
3. The Master of Arts in Public Policy and Governance is a 2 year full time degree programme that systematically and critically explores the nature and practice of complex public problem solving in a developing constitutional democracy. The programme draws on the disciplines of law, economics, history, philosophy, politics and anthropology to devise an interdisciplinary curriculum that encourages deep ethical reflections on public choice and programme implementation in Indian states.
4. Masters in Law: Azim Premji University launched a one-year Post Graduate Programme in Law and Development (Masters in Law / LL.M.) in 2016 that seeks to initiate a decisive, novel and meaningful intervention at the intersection of the domains of Law and Development in India. The LL.M. in Law & Development at Azim Premji University is unique in having a law faculty dedicated exclusively to post graduate teaching.
5.M.A. in Economics: The M.A in Economics is a uniquely designed programme to develop the next generation of Economists with the theoretical knowledge, and technical skills to perform high quality analysis, while at the same time being grounded in the institutional, developmental and ecological context of contemporary India.
